Handover note — Crumbwheel order cutoffs.

Welcome aboard. The bakery cutoff rule in Crumbwheel closes same-day orders at 14:00 local to each storefront, not UTC — this has bitten us twice. Holiday overrides live in the calendar service and take precedence silently, so always check there first when a cutoff looks wrong. To unlock the calendar service's admin console after a restart, enter the recovery passphrase below.

vault phrase of bagap-bahaf = silion-pelox-sorox-casdor-quenwyn-fraax-eliox-praael-kelion-quenvan-kasox-rusael-norius-belvan

## Deployment

The Paylune payments service has a known set of flaky integration tests around settlement retries. Do not skip them: rerun the suite up to three times and require two consecutive green runs before tagging a release. Flakes correlate with the mock clearing-house simulator starting slowly, so give it a 60-second warmup. Record any third-attempt passes in the release log for the stability review. Once the suite is green, the deploy pipeline provisions the environment with the configuration values shown below.

settings of fafog-haduf:
ZORIX_PIN=4648
ZORIX_METRICS_HOST=metrics.zorix.paliqsys.corp
ZORIX_LOG_LEVEL=info
ZORIX_TENANT=druix

Subject: Cold start improvements for Pinefold handlers

Hello support team — we have deployed provisioned warm pools for the Pinefold serverless handlers, which should reduce first-request latency from several seconds to under 400 ms. If a customer still reports slow initial responses, please note the region and time precisely. Reference the deployment using the build token directly below.

trace token, fafog-kageg: htk4_98e6

## v4.2.0 — Default changes

The Stockhopper restock planner now defaults to a 4-hour planning horizon (previously 12) and excludes machines flagged as seasonal. Route batching is on by default, which shortens morning runs for the Velmora depot fleet. Operators who relied on the longer horizon must override it explicitly before this release ships. The new shipped defaults are as follows.

service settings:
PRAIX_LOG_LEVEL=error
PRAIX_METRICS_HOST=metrics.praix.qorvelcorp.corp
PRAIX_POOL_SIZE=16